NSCDC apprehends 2 suspected pipeline vandals in Plateau

The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ps (NSCDC) said on Tuesday that it apprehended two suspected pipeline vandals in Bassa Local Government Area of Plateau.
It?s commandant in the state, Vincent Bature, said in Jos that the command had beefed up surveillance to curb the menace particularly around the NNPC depot in jos.
?I personally visited the NNPC depot here in the state due to the incessant reports we have been getting on the activities of the pipeline vandals.
?I assured them that surveillance would be intensified to apprehend the vandals, we had to strategies because we have been trained for it; we were able to apprehend these two men here.?
Bature said that the suspects would soon be handed over to the appropriate authority for further investigation.
He said that the act of pipeline vandalism had affected the state because fuel and diesel could not be pumped into the state.
?That is the major problem here, fuel and diesel cannot be pumped from Kaduna because the moment they pump, informants would tell them and they would go and vandalize the pipes to get the product.?
He, however, warned the vandals to desist from the act, adding that operatives of the command would always be on ground to curb such illegal activities in the state.
The commandant called on the traditional ruler in Bassa Local Government Area to sensitize his people to the danger inherent in such nefarious activities.
He describe the destruction of pipeline as ??a national sabotage??.
Bature listed 23 gallons of diesel, four motorcycles, basins and machetes as the items recovered from the suspects.
